Subject: On-call handover — Quillbridge health checks

Handing over from the weekend shift. The Quillbridge API nodes behind the Farrow load balancer had two flapping health checks Saturday; I raised the check interval to 30s and it stabilised. New folks: health check config lives in the balancer repo, not the service repo. If anything flaps again, page the platform rota at the address below.

escalation mailbox, yajeg-bageg: quenax.olidor@lumiccorp.internal

Handover note for the facilities desk, from Marisol to Detlef: the mail room move from the ground floor of Copperleaf House to the basement annexe finishes Thursday. Courier deliveries should be redirected to the annexe hatch from Friday morning. The old room stays locked until the shelving is collected; keep the trolley down there until then. Sorting bins are already labelled by floor. The annexe door has a new keypad fitted this week, and the code for it is below.

turnstile pass: bdg-TXR-4

Subject: Quickstore 4.2 — bloom filter now fronts the KV layer

Plugin authors: starting with this release, Quickstore places a bloom filter ahead of the key-value store. Negative lookups return faster; false positives fall through safely. No API changes are required on your side. Verify your plugin against the staging build referenced below.

session token of fahif-tadup = htk3_9c7

Runbook: SQL lint gate for Quarrelstone CI. Rules live in `lint/sqlrules.toml`; violations block merge. Common failures: unqualified table refs, missing `-- owner:` headers, nondeterministic ORDER BY in views. To run locally: `qlint ./migrations`. The linter fetches rule updates from the internal Ledgewell rules feed on each run; offline mode is not supported in CI. If the feed call 401s, the runner env is missing its feed credential. Fix by appending the feed access secret to the runner env file on the next line.

sealed setting: ARCHIVE_KEY3=8d0

## Artifact Signing: Health Checks Behind Balefront

All services behind the Balefront load balancer expose `/healthz`, which Balefront polls every five seconds. Deployed artifacts must pass health checks on two consecutive polls before receiving traffic, and every artifact must carry a valid signature or Balefront rejects it. Sign release bundles with the key below.

signing key of bagap-yawep = bky13_TbfT6ZMUoGJo2